ABHUINN A' GHLINNE | Abhuinn a' Ghlinne | Mr Hugh Buie, Shepherd Bonaveh Mr John McPhee farmer Scruitten Mr James Mun tenant Kilchattan |
155 | Applies to a small stream rising out of "Loch an Sgùid" flowing first N.W. [North West] then N [North] and falls into "Loch Fada" a short distance W [West] of "Drisaig." English meaning:- "River of the glen" |
AN GLEANN | An Gleann | Mr Hugh Buie, Shepherd Bonaveh Mr John McPhee farmer Scruitten Mr James Mun tenant Kilchattan |
155 | Applies to a hollow, the south end of which is a short distance W [West] of "Loch an Sgùid." and N [North] to "Loch Fadad" a short distance [West] of "Drisaig" English meaning:- "The Glen" |
DRISAIG | Drisaig | Mr Hugh Buie, Shepherd Bonaveh Mr John McPhee farmer Scruitten Mr James Mun tenant Kilchattan |
155 | Applies to a hillside on the south side of "Loch Fada" a short distance East of "An Gleann" |
